President Trump tweeted late Saturday afternoon that he plans to skip the annual White House Correspondents’ Dinner.

“I will not be attending the White House Correspondents' Association Dinner this year,” the tweet reads. “Please wish everyone well and have a great evening!”

His decision to opt out of the dinner comes amid his ongoing battle with the press.  

The annual black-tie event attended by journalists, celebrities, and traditionally the president and first lady, features awards and scholarships for rising stars in journalism. 

Attending the dinner has been a tradition for presidents since it began in the early 1920's.

The last president to skip the event was Ronald Reagan in 1981, uanable to attend because he was recovering from an assassination attempt. Even so, Reagan phoned in and delivered remarks to the dinner's attendees. 

The White House Correspondents’ Association (WHCA) issued a statement on Saturday following Trump’s announcement, saying, in essence, that despite the President’s lack in attendance, the show will go on.

“The White House Correspondents' Association looks forward to having its annual dinner on April 29,” writes WHCA president Jeff Mason. “The WHCA takes note of President Donald Trump's announcement on Twitter that he does not plan to attend the dinner, which has been and will continue to be a celebration of the First Amendment and the important role played by an independent news media in a healthy republic. We look forward to shining a spotlight at the dinner on some of the best political journalism of the past year and recognizing the promising students who represent the next generation of our profession."
